What Does a Business Lawyer in San Antonio Do?

A business lawyer in San Antonio provides legal guidance for businesses of all sizes — from startups to established companies. An experienced San Antonio business attorney handles entity formation, contract drafting and review, regulatory compliance, disputes, and transactions. Having the right legal counsel protects your business from costly mistakes and litigation.

How Much Does a Business Lawyer Cost in San Antonio?

Business lawyer fees vary by service. Entity formation: $500–$2,000. Contract drafting: $500–$3,000. Hourly consultation: $200–$500/hr. Ongoing retainer: $1,000–$5,000/month. Litigation: $5,000–$50,000+.

Typical fee structure: Hourly ($200–$500/hr) or flat fee by service

Frequently Asked Questions — Business Lawyer in San Antonio

❓ How much does a business lawyer cost?

Formation: $500–$2,000. Contracts: $500–$3,000. Hourly: $200–$500/hr. Monthly retainer: $1,000–$5,000. Litigation: $5,000–$50,000+.

❓ What type of business entity should I form?

LLC, S-Corp, C-Corp, or partnership — each has different tax, liability, and management implications. A business lawyer helps you choose the right structure for your goals.

❓ Do I need a lawyer to start a business?

Not legally required, but highly recommended. A lawyer ensures proper formation, operating agreements, licensing, and contracts — avoiding costly mistakes that are hard to fix later.

❓ When should I hire a business lawyer?

Before forming your business, signing major contracts, bringing on partners or investors, handling disputes, or making significant business decisions.

❓ What should be in a business contract?

Clear terms, payment details, deliverables, timelines, termination clauses, dispute resolution provisions, confidentiality, and liability limitations.

❓ How do I protect my personal assets from business liability?

Form an LLC or corporation, maintain separate finances, follow corporate formalities, and carry adequate insurance. A lawyer ensures proper liability protection.
